Cpl. Wassef Ali Hassoun, USMC

Terrorists in Iraq have kidnapped a US Marine, Cpl. Wassef Ali Hassoun, and are threatening to behead him if their demands are not met. While little is clear at this stage, one or two points are immediately obvious:

(1) These pigs are making a huge tactical mistake.

(2) They are equal-opportunity, anti-human, anti-civilization killers.

(3) Let's roll.